How To Tie A Tie
As a courtesy to our customers, we offer this informative section that explains, step by step, how to tie four of the most common necktie knots.

Situate the tie so end "A" is longer than end "B" and cross "A" over "B". Turn end "A" back under "B". Bring "A" back over in front of "B" again.
Pull "A" up and through the loop around your neck. Hold the knot loosely and bring "A" down through the front loop. Tighten knot snuggly to collar by holding "B" and sliding the knot.


Situate the tie so end "A" is longer than end "B" and cross "A" over "B". Bring "A" up around and behind "B". Bring "A" up.
Pull "A" up and through the loop. Bring "A" around front, over "B" from left to right. Again, bring "A" up and through the loop.
Bring "A" down through the knot in front. Using both hands, tighten the knot and draw up to collar.


Situate the tie so end "A" is longer than end "B" and cross "A" over "B". Bring "A" up through loop between collar and tie; then back down. Pull "A" underneath "B" and to the left, and back through the loop again.
Bring "A" across the front from left to right. Pull "A" up through the loop again. Bring "A" down through the knot in front.
Using both hands, tighten the knot and draw up to collar.


BOWTIE
1. Start with end in right hand extending 1" below that in left hand.
2. Cross the longer end over the short end then pass it back and up through the loop making a loose overhand knot. Tighten the knot so it fits snugly around your neck.
3. Fold the lower hanging end up and to the left. Make sure the unfolded end is hanging down over the front of the bow.
4. Pull the bow ends forward and gently squeeze them together, forming an opening behind them. Now, turn to the right and notice the opening you have created.
5. With your left thumb or forefinger, push the middle part ot the tie with your finger through the opening from left to right, taking care not to let the end of the tie pass all the way through the opening. Use your right hand to help pull the back loop through.
6. Your bow tie will be uneven at this point. Pull the loop ends to tighten the bow. This is where your personal touch comes in. You can make a small knot or large knot. To take your bow tie off, simply pull the straight ends.
